Leadership Review Briefing — Sales Leads Only

Topic: Support outsourcing to Kessler Ridge Services

Proposal: migrate tier-one support for the Veldane product line to Kessler Ridge by quarter end. Expected cost reduction: 22%. Internal team refocuses on enterprise escalations. Risks: response-time dip during transition, est. six weeks. Customer comms drafted; do not distribute yet. Decision required at Thursday's review. The underlying business rationale is summarised in the note that follows.

board note of baweg-bawig: Project Tamath slips by six weeks because of the audit delay.

# StormPing fan-out service — env notes for support folks
#
# This service takes one weather alert and blasts it out to every
# subscribed channel (SMS bridge, app push, the Kettleford siren board).
# If fan-out stalls, check the queue depth first — nine times out of ten
# it's a stuck worker, not config. The dispatcher also needs to sign
# each outbound batch, so right below this comment goes its signing credential:

secret setting of yajog-taguf: ARCHIVE_KEY3=051

### Tilecrab prefetcher — restart procedure

Drain the fetch queue first; killing mid-batch corrupts the region cache. Restart only via the supervisor, never directly. Verify cache-hit rate recovers within five minutes. If it doesn't, wipe the warm tier and reseed from the Quillmark basin dataset. Confirm the running process picked up these values.

settings of fafog-haduf:
ZORIX_PIN=4648
ZORIX_METRICS_HOST=metrics.zorix.paliqsys.corp
ZORIX_LOG_LEVEL=info
ZORIX_TENANT=druix